About
Marion Scott Gallery is pleased to announce a new exhibition featuring the expressions of six artists from three different northern Canadian communities. Opening July 18 and continuing through August 15, Outsiders: Inuit Masters brings together works in a range of two- and three-dimensional media by some of the Arctic’s most distinguished artists.
Although well known to the Inuit art world, the six featured artists—John Kavik, Thomassie Kudluk, Elizabeth Nutaraaluk Aulatjut, Françoise Oklaga, Bessie Scottie Iquginnaaq and Annie Taipanak—each maintained a practice that developed in some measure independently of local and regional artistic traditions, producing idiosyncratic works that compel and startle us with their originality.
Powerful in their singularity, the different bodies of works in the exhibition are united by a common directness of expression and an unconventional approach to technique and material usage.
